Abstract
Active acoustic attenuation uses a secondary source to control an undesired disturbance from a primary source of sound or vibration. In this paper, a generalized recursive control system is presented that can be used to implement a variety of fully adaptive feedforward and feedback control schemes. Three recursive adaptive filters simultaneously provide improved modeling of the feedforward path, the feedback path, and the secondary path to enable application of the filtered-X or filtered-U algorithms. These schemes have been applied to a variety of sound and vibration control problems
